The knack with any presentation of this type

is to link the book to the real world. You'll need to spend quite a while watching and/or reading the news but you should be able to find examples of people doing in the real world what they did in the book. (If not, it was a crap book, 'cos that's what it was intended to do! ).

Then, when you've got your comparisons lined up, just let 'em go - go through them one at a time, using plenty of energy: this last bit's important. In our presentation skills training we've found that the most surefire way to make a presentation boring is to be afraid that it will be! That means you don't commit yourself fully and the audience interpret that lack of passion by you *about your presentation* as a lack of passtion from you *about the subject*.
